fn defaults_for_exit_code(code: ExitCode) -> (&'static str, bool, Option<&'static str>) {
match code {
ExitCode::Success => ("success", false, None),
ExitCode::GeneralError => ("general_error", false, None),
ExitCode::UsageError => ("usage_error", false, Some(USAGE_SUGGESTION)),
ExitCode::NetworkError => ("network_error", true, Some(NETWORK_SUGGESTION)),
ExitCode::AuthError => ("auth_error", false, Some(AUTH_SUGGESTION)),
ExitCode::NotFound => ("not_found", false, Some(NOT_FOUND_SUGGESTION)),
ExitCode::Conflict => ("conflict", false, Some(CONFLICT_SUGGESTION)),
ExitCode::UnsupportedFeature => {
("unsupported_feature", false, Some(UNSUPPORTED_SUGGESTION))
}
ExitCode::Interrupted => (
"interrupted",
true,
Some("Retry the command if you still need the operation to complete."),
),
}
}
fn infer_error_metadata(message: &str) -> (&'static str, bool, Option<String>) {
let normalized = message.to_ascii_lowercase();
if normalized.contains("not found") || normalized.contains("does not exist") {
return ("not_found", false, Some(NOT_FOUND_SUGGESTION.to_string()));
}
if normalized.contains("access denied")
|| normalized.contains("unauthorized")
|| normalized.contains("forbidden")
|| normalized.contains("authentication")
|| normalized.contains("credentials")
{
return ("auth_error", false, Some(AUTH_SUGGESTION.to_string()));
}
if normalized.contains("invalid")
|| normalized.contains("cannot be empty")
|| normalized.contains("must be")
|| normalized.contains("must specify")
|| normalized.contains("expected:")
|| normalized.contains("use -r/--recursive")
{
return ("usage_error", false, Some(USAGE_SUGGESTION.to_string()));
}
if normalized.contains("already exists")
|| normalized.contains("conflict")
|| normalized.contains("precondition")
|| normalized.contains("destination exists")
{
return ("conflict", false, Some(CONFLICT_SUGGESTION.to_string()));
}
if normalized.contains("does not support")
|| normalized.contains("unsupported")
|| normalized.contains("not yet supported")
{
return (
"unsupported_feature",
false,
Some(UNSUPPORTED_SUGGESTION.to_string()),
);
}
if normalized.contains("timeout")
|| normalized.contains("network")
|| normalized.contains("connection")
|| normalized.contains("temporarily unavailable")
|| normalized.contains("failed to create s3 client")
{
return ("network_error", true, Some(NETWORK_SUGGESTION.to_string()));
}
("general_error", false, None)
}
